Deforestation is the large-scale cutting down and removal of forests to use the land for other purposes such as agriculture, urban development, and industrial expansion. Forests are one of the most important natural resources on Earth. They provide oxygen, regulate climate, support biodiversity, and protect soil. When forests are removed, the balance of nature is disturbed, leading to serious environmental consequences.
Across the world, forests are being cleared at an alarming rate. Trees are cut to create farmland, build cities, construct roads, and establish industries. While development is necessary, uncontrolled deforestation creates long-term problems such as soil erosion, floods, droughts, rising temperatures, and climate imbalance.
Forests are often called the “lungs of the Earth” because they absorb carbon dioxide and release oxygen. When trees are cut, carbon stored in them is released into the atmosphere, contributing to global warming. Additionally, wildlife loses its habitat, leading to biodiversity loss.

Major Causes of Deforestation
Deforestation does not happen randomly. It occurs mainly due to human activities.
1. Agriculture Expansion
Farmers clear forests to grow crops or raise livestock. This is one of the biggest causes globally.
2. Urbanization
As cities expand, forests are cut to build houses, roads, and infrastructure.
3. Industrial Development
Factories, mining projects, and construction activities require land, leading to tree removal.
4. Logging
Trees are cut for timber, paper, and furniture production.
5. Infrastructure Projects
Highways, dams, and railways often require clearing forest areas.
Environmental Effects of Deforestation
Deforestation has serious environmental consequences.
1. Soil Erosion
Trees hold soil together with their roots. When trees are removed, soil becomes loose and easily washed away.
2. Floods
Without trees to absorb rainwater, water flows rapidly, causing floods.
3. Droughts
Forests help maintain the water cycle. Cutting trees reduces rainfall in many areas.
4. Rise in Temperature
Trees provide shade and absorb carbon dioxide. Their removal increases global temperatures.
5. Climate Imbalance
Large-scale deforestation disrupts climate patterns and accelerates global warming.
Impact on Wildlife and Biodiversity
Forests are home to millions of species. When trees are cut:
- Animals lose their habitats
- Food chains are disturbed
- Species become endangered or extinct
This leads to biodiversity loss, which weakens ecosystems.
Chain Reaction of Deforestation
Deforestation creates a clear environmental chain:
Trees cut → Soil erosion → Floods/Droughts → Climate imbalance
This chain shows how one action can trigger multiple problems.
How Deforestation Affects the Climate
Forests absorb carbon dioxide, a greenhouse gas responsible for global warming. When forests are destroyed:
- Carbon dioxide levels increase
- Oxygen production decreases
- Global temperature rises
Deforestation is one of the major contributors to climate change.

Solutions to Deforestation
Deforestation can be controlled with sustainable practices.
1. Afforestation and Reforestation
Planting new trees in deforested areas helps restore balance.
2. Sustainable Agriculture
Using land efficiently without expanding into forests.
3. Forest Conservation Laws
Governments can regulate logging and protect forest areas.
4. Reduce Paper and Wood Waste
Using recycled materials lowers demand for tree cutting.
5. Community Awareness
Educating people about environmental protection encourages responsible actions.
